Eligibility

Eligibility:

  • Applicants who currently live in Adams County, OH and applicants whose household includes a US Veteran are given priority.
  • Applicants' annual household income must be within the low-income limit set by HUD, which cannot exceed 50% of the median income for the area.
  • Each person who would reside in the unit must be a US citizen or non-citizen with eligible immigration status.

Application process

Online application required to join the waiting list when open. The waiting list may close and stop accepting applications periodically.

Fees

No fee to apply. Rent for qualified applicants is based on 30-40% of monthly adjusted gross income.

Service area

Adams County, Ohio

Description

Provides subsidized housing for low income families and individuals within Housing Authority-owned properties, including high-rise buildings, multi-family homes, and scattered site single-family homes located in Manchester, Seaman/Winchester, and Peebles.
